If I were honest with myself, this might just be a half cup too big on me. I normally wear a 30G in UK bras (freya, etc). The band on this runs incredibly tight. It is quite comfortable on me for the first few hours then after a while it starts to dig in. So the 70 in this bra fits more like a 65, in my opinion. Regardless, it is incredibly comfortable and made of delightfully soft materials. It comes with two pads to fix asymmetry, which is quite useful since my right one is slightly smaller. https://d28qt14g3opchh.cloudfront.net/smileys/icon_smile.gif" alt=":)" />
My only gripe is that due to the cup construction, a lot of weight is on the straps, causing them to dig in if I have them pulled up as tight as I'd like. I also wish the straps were .5-1" over more . They don't chaff my arms, but I am concerned with a lot of movement that they will. Perhaps I'll have to do some bra surgery.
